President George W. Bush was welcomed at the National Religious Broadcasters convention in Nashville yesterday as he delivered something the broadcasters wanted to hear – a pledge to veto any legislation to bring back the Fairness Doctrine. Bush told the gathering that such regulation would “stifle” the freedom of Christian broadcasters to spread their message. "We know who these advocates of so-called balance really have in their sights: shows hosted by people like Rush Limbaugh and James Dobson,” the President said. Rather, Bush told the Religious Broadcasters, “you are the balance.”
